As the C/H ratio of the fuel increases, the amount of CO2 formed on combustion _______________ for the same percentage of excess air?
Correct answer: B. Increases
- A. Decreases
- B. Increases
- C. Remain same
- D. May increase or decrease depending on the type of fuel
Explanation
Increasing the C/H ratio increases the carbon available per unit mass of fuel, so more carbon is converted to CO2 under comparable combustion conditions. The same excess-air percentage does not reverse this trend.
